Abstract

The study aims to explore the challenges faced by the tenth-grade students in learning to write a recount text through discovery learning using short video. The study used a descriptive qualitative method approach. Hence, the researcher collected the data by using interviews, observations, and document analysis. And then, the participants who participated in this study were 17 students of a senior high school located in Bandung. After gathering the data, the researcher then analyzed and coded them to make interpretations about the findings. The result revealed that the challenges faced by the students in creating a recount text include limited English proficiency. Additionally, it is recommended for further research to explore other areas like factors that may influence the effectiveness of using discovery learning through short videos in teaching writing recount text.
